Buyer’s Guide

How to Choose the Right Course

  1. Accreditation:
    Ensure the program is accredited by a recognized body, offering credibility to your qualification.

  2. Curriculum Focus:
    Examine course offerings to ensure they cover areas of interest such as sustainable design, spatial planning, or interior decorating.

  3. Flexible Options:
    Consider whether you prefer in-person learning or need the flexibility of online courses.

  4. Career Support:
    Look for programs offering career services, including internships and job placement assistance.


FAQ

What is the job outlook for interior designers in Halifax?

The demand for interior designers in Halifax is expected to grow as the city continues to develop, making it a promising career choice.

Are online courses in interior design reputable?

Yes, many online programs are accredited and provide quality education, but it’s essential to Research their reputation.

What skills will I learn in interior design courses?

Students will typically learn spatial planning, Color theory, Furniture selection, Lighting design, and sustainable practices.

How long does it take to become a certified interior designer?

The time varies by program; diploma courses may take 1-2 years, while degree programs could take 4 years.

What should I do after completing my interior design course?

Consider internships to gain practical experience and begin building your Portfolio, which is essential for job applications.
